Php 带有两个实体的Symfony2实体表单字段

Php 带有两个实体的Symfony2实体表单字段,php,forms,symfony,entity,Php,Forms,Symfony,Entity,我想在我的表单中创建一个包含2个实体的选择下拉列表 $form = $this->createFormBuilder(new VisitEvent()) ->add('date', 'text') ->add('where', 'entity', array( 'class' => 'PGMainBundle:Field', 'property' => 'name', )

我想在我的表单中创建一个包含2个实体的选择下拉列表

$form = $this->createFormBuilder(new VisitEvent())
     ->add('date', 'text')
     ->add('where', 'entity', array(
                'class' => 'PGMainBundle:Field',
                'property' => 'name',
     )
)
我想在下拉列表中同时使用两个实体。我这里有一个,第二个是模拟器。我想知道我应该采取什么方法

将这两个实体合并到一个数组中,并将其传递给一个选择字段


或者有更好的方法将其用于实体字段吗?

当您同时说两个实体时,您的意思是什么?你想做什么?一个结合了字段和模拟器的下拉列表。同样来自不同的类别你应该依靠一些接口和通道来形成一个数组集合(组合字段和模拟器)。我需要类似的东西,我想从两个不同的实体中选择项目,fe:在我的实体博客中,一个字段可以从产品和促销实体中选择项目。我想知道如何实现这一点。谢谢